The Georgia Tech Career Center in partnership with Ivan Allen College of Liberal Arts is hosting the 3rd annual Liberal Arts Career fair. Students are invited to connect with and recruiters from an array of technological and innovative companies and expand their network before entering the workforce. The event will take place via CareerBuzz on March 1, 2021, from 2 pm-4 pm To register for the event, click here.

Join the Student Alumni Association
The Student Alumni Association (SAA) aims to provide students with opportunities that broaden their college experience, strengthen traditions, and foster lifelong participation with Georgia Tech. SAA works to connect current Tech students with a network of alumni mentors to help build their professional skills and network. For more information and to join SAA, click here. To foster these connections, SAA hosts a variety of events, this year virtually, such as mentoring sessions, networking sessions, and alumni speakers. Read MoreInternational Institute for Strategic Studies Presents: A Tumultuous Transition
The International Institute for Strategic Studies (IISS) Student Ambassadors Program is hosting “A Tumultuous Transition: Reactions from Friends, Foes, and the Ramifications for International Security”. During this webinar, a panel of IISS experts will discuss the transition into the new American administration. The panel will consider the unprecedented U.S. capitol insurrection and the events that took place during the formal transition from the Trump administration to the Biden administration and the broad reactions of world leaders and the world population.
